X-Git-Url: http://git.efficios.com/?p=babeltrace.git;a=blobdiff_plain;f=src%2Fplugins%2Fctf%2Fcommon%2Fmetadata%2Fparser.y;h=cb4eb74f42fbfbf7f1416a58cb7fe4a18a72443b;hp=a75cff056afc4233a5473bffbb23d596db537f9b;hb=50f6fce8d00bc6b70a814a0be3b71570fb65d070;hpb=49a43e69c6ca442956f894029d0d8e2acae8b041 diff --git a/src/plugins/ctf/common/metadata/parser.y b/src/plugins/ctf/common/metadata/parser.y index a75cff05..cb4eb74f 100644 --- a/src/plugins/ctf/common/metadata/parser.y +++ b/src/plugins/ctf/common/metadata/parser.y @@ -266,7 +266,7 @@ int import_string(struct ctf_scanner *scanner, YYSTYPE *lvalp, lvalp->s = objstack_alloc(scanner->objstack, len); if (src[0] == 'L') { // TODO: import wide string - _BT_LOGE_LINENO(yyget_lineno(scanner), + _BT_LOGE_APPEND_CAUSE_LINENO(yyget_lineno(scanner), "wide characters are not supported as of this version: " "scanner-addr=%p", scanner); return -1; @@ -352,7 +352,7 @@ static struct ctf_node *make_node(struct ctf_scanner *scanner, node = objstack_alloc(scanner->objstack, sizeof(*node)); if (!node) { - _BT_LOGE_LINENO(yyget_lineno(scanner->scanner), + _BT_LOGE_APPEND_CAUSE_LINENO(yyget_lineno(scanner->scanner), "failed to allocate one stack entry: " "scanner-addr=%p", scanner); return &error_node; @@ -922,7 +922,7 @@ static int set_parent_node(struct ctf_node *node, static void yyerror(struct ctf_scanner *scanner, yyscan_t yyscanner, const char *str) { - _BT_LOGE_LINENO(yyget_lineno(scanner->scanner), + _BT_LOGE_APPEND_CAUSE_LINENO(yyget_lineno(scanner->scanner), "%s: token=\"%s\"", str, yyget_text(scanner->scanner)); }